We now know that you have a P4 3.06GHz processor, 1GB of RAM, and a 160GB hard drive.

However it doesnt list the power supply specs. What you can do is open up the side panel to your case, and on the power supply it should say the wattage and list the amps for each rail. Just a note, the power supply is the box which you plug the power cable into.

Yes the 8800GTS is a great card. It uses the PCI-E interface (not PCI), however from the specs you gave us in the first post, you have a PCI-E x16 slot so you're all set. As for it being GDDR3, that doesnt make any difference, the RAM in your computer has nothing to do with compatibility of the RAM on the video card.

I have my doubts that you can use your existing power supply though, but we will say for sure when you get back home.
